Cultivating Aloe vera throughout the year is definitely possible, especially if you keep it as an indoor houseplant. Since these succulents thrive in temperatures between 55°F and 85°F, they fit perfectly into most home environments. To maintain their health, ensure they sit in a sunny spot and that you significantly reduce watering during the winter dormancy period. Aloe vera is able to be grown in warm climates that have mild winters, which is usually in the USDA zones 9-11. It grows in dry soils that are situated in the sun. Nevertheless, it is not frost-tolerant and may be damaged when the temperatures are below the freezing point. You can save aloe in a pot in cooler regions so that you can take it inside when the weather changes to cold.
